As with any diamond, you have a number options when looking at yellow diamond engagement rings.
- There is the solitaire. This classic look is often the first choice among women. Yellow diamond solitaires are usually mounted in gold, white gold or platinum settings.
- Three and five stone sets are also popular. This look features a principle diamond with either two or four smaller diamonds along each side. The yellow feature stone is wonderfully set off by the smaller near colourless diamonds.
- The cluster look. While most often worn as a dress ring, cluster rings are becoming more and more popular as an engagement ring. It usually is made up of five or more stones, smaller in size and may even different colored diamonds for a gorgeous effect.
